A healthcare practice in Berkshire is seeking a committed GP Partner to join their friendly team due to an upcoming retirement. The role includes conducting consultations, participating in the duty doctor rota, and attending regular meetings.
The practice highly values patient satisfaction and offers a competitive annual leave package along with the opportunity to develop special interests. Located in beautiful Buckler's Park, the practice boasts excellent transport links and a strong focus on work-life balance.
